企业官网部署在云服务器上,CPU密集型还是内存优化型配置更合适?

企业官网通常既不是典型的CPU密集型,也不是典型的内存密集型应用,因此通用型(General Purpose)配置通常是更合适、更经济的选择;但在特定场景下,可结合实际情况微调。以下是具体分析和建议:

为什么一般不推荐纯CPU密集型或纯内存优化型?

类型 适用场景 官网是否匹配? 原因
CPU密集型(如 c7, C6, m7i) 视频转码、科学计算、实时渲染、高并发Java服务(未优化GC) ❌ 通常不匹配 官网主要为静态页面、轻量CMS(如WordPress)、Nginx/Apache反向X_X + PHP/Node.js后端,CPU消耗低;峰值请求时CPU占用通常<30%,过度配置造成浪费。
内存优化型(如 r7, R6, u-6tb128x) 大型数据库(MySQL/PostgreSQL缓存)、内存数据库(Redis集群)、大数据分析 ❌ 一般不必要 单机部署的官网,即使含CMS+缓存(如Redis单实例),1–4GB内存已足够;除非自建Elasticsearch全文检索或运行多个高内存服务,否则内存冗余。

官网典型负载特征:

  • ✅ 高并发读(大量用户访问HTML/CSS/JS/图片)→ 依赖I/O性能(磁盘/网络)和缓存(CDN、浏览器缓存、服务端缓存)
  • ✅ 低计算开销(PHP/Python渲染快,Node.js轻量路由)→ CPU压力小
  • ✅ 内存需求稳定(Web服务器+PHP-FPM进程池/Node事件循环)→ 通常2–4GB足够(中小型企业官网)
  • ✅ 关键瓶颈常在:带宽、CDN响应、数据库慢查询、未启用Gzip/Brotli压缩、无OPcache/Redis缓存

推荐配置策略(按规模):

官网规模 推荐云服务器类型 典型配置 理由
小型(年PV < 50万,无后台系统) 通用型(如阿里云 ecs.g7、腾讯云 S6、AWS t3/t4g) 2核4GB + SSD云盘 + CDN + 对象存储(存图片) 成本低、弹性好;t系列支持突发性能,应对流量小高峰
中型(PV 50万–500万,含CMS/表单/简单API) 通用型增强版(如阿里云 ecs.c7、AWS m6i) 4核8GB + 100GB SSD + Redis缓存(云数据库) 平衡CPU/内存,预留扩展空间;避免用r系列“大内存”但CPU弱导致PHP响应延迟
大型/高可用(PV >500万,多语言/会员系统/实时数据看板) 分层部署(不单靠一台):
• 前端:通用型(NGINX静态服务)
• 应用:通用型(4–8核)
• 数据库:单独内存优化型(RDS for MySQL with 8GB+ RAM)
• 缓存:Redis集群
拆分架构比单机堆配更重要;官网本身仍用通用型,重负载组件(DB/Cache)才用专用型

比选型更重要的优化项(优先级更高):

  1. 强制使用CDN(如Cloudflare、阿里云DCDN)——解决90%的静态资源访问延迟
  2. 开启HTTP/2 + Brotli压缩 + 浏览器强缓存(Cache-Control)
  3. PHP启用OPcache / Node.js使用Cluster模式 / Python用Gunicorn+Worker预热
  4. 数据库连接池化 + 慢查询优化 + 索引检查(哪怕只是MySQL单机)
  5. 日志分离 + 定期清理(避免磁盘IO拖慢)

⚠️ 注意避坑:

  • ❌ 不要为“未来增长”盲目选高配——云服务器支持在线升降配,先选小配+监控(CPU/内存/磁盘IO/网络),按需扩容;
  • ❌ 避免选择“计算型”却忽略带宽限制(很多低价实例带宽仅1Mbps,打开首页就超时);
  • ❌ 内存优化型若用于纯Web服务,可能因CPU核数少(如r7 2核64GB),导致高并发时请求排队(CPU成为瓶颈)。

✅ 总结建议:

首选通用型实例(2–4核 + 4–8GB内存),搭配CDN、对象存储、云数据库和基础缓存,再通过架构与配置优化提升性能。把预算和精力放在「可观测性(监控告警)」和「自动化运维(CI/CD、备份恢复)」上,远比纠结CPU还是内存型更有实际价值。

如需进一步建议,可提供:官网技术栈(如 WordPress / Vue SPA + Spring Boot / Next.js等)、预估日均UV/PV、是否含后台管理系统或API接口,我可以帮你定制配置方案。

未经允许不得转载:云知识CLOUD » 企业官网部署在云服务器上,CPU密集型还是内存优化型配置更合适?